My Travel Skincare Ritual: Nourishment First, Always

Travel is a gift, but if I’m honest, my skin doesn’t always see it that way. Airplane air, shifts in climate, hotel water, and the inevitable irregularity of routines all seem to conspire against me. Within a day or two of being on the road, I can almost guarantee that my complexion will start showing signs of stress—tightness, flakiness, and that uncomfortable dry feeling I wouldn’t wish on anyone.

Through trial and error, I’ve learned that the best way to care for my skin while traveling is to simplify. I leave the exfoliating acids and stronger actives at home and instead build a pared-down lineup of products that focus purely on hydration, barrier support, and restoration. This strategy not only keeps my skin comfortable in the moment but also ensures it recovers more quickly once I’m back to my regular routine.

A Philosophy That Works Anywhere

Over the years, I’ve learned that skincare during travel isn’t about perfection—it’s about protection and repair. The goal isn’t to try new actives or keep up a complicated routine, but to honor what my skin truly needs: hydration, comfort, and a strong barrier.
